Módulo: DOC. EXPORTAÇÃO
Funcionalidade: Outros
Data/Hora da Publicação: 18/01/2008 00:00:00
Data/Hora Última Alteração: 21/02/2011 16:53:47
Descrição da Nota: MELHORIAS TÉCNICAS NO GRUPO DE FUNÇÕES 1 (CODE INSPECTOR)
Sintoma
Haviam alguns pontos problemáticos para ajuste, apontados pelo Code Inspector.
Solução
Os erros corrigidos ou ocultados.
Informações Complementares
----------------------------------------------------------------------------------------------------
Nota Número 05680 Data: 18/01/2008 Hora: 07:36:22
----------------------------------------------------------------------------------------------------
----------------------------------------------------------------------------------------------------
Nota Número : 05680
Categoria : Melhoria
Prioridade : Baixa
Versão PW.CE : 7.0
Pacote : 00004
Agrupamento : 00030
----------------------------------------------------------------------------------------------------
Referência às notas relacionadas:
Número - Ordem - Versão - Pacote - Descrição Breve
04921 - 00001 - 7.0 - 00003 - CRIAÇÃO DA VISÃO /PWS/ZYCEV023.
04979 - 00002 - 7.0 - 00003 - CRIAÇÃO DA VISÃO ZYCEV020.
05103 - 00003 - 7.0 - 00003 - CRIAÇÃO DA VISÃO ZYCEV130.
----------------------------------------------------------------------------------------------------
MELHORIAS TÉCNICAS NO GRUPO DE FUNÇÕES 1 (CODE INSPECTOR)
----------------------------------------------------------------------------------------------------
Palavras Chave:
CODE INSPECTOR SCI GRUPO DE FUNÇÕES DIÁLOGO DE ATUALIZAÇÃO
----------------------------------------------------------------------------------------------------
Objetos da nota:
FUGR /PWS/ZYCEGF1
----------------------------------------------------------------------------------------------------
Modificações efetuadas em FUGR /PWS/ZYCEGF1
No grupo de funções /PWS/ZYCEGF1:
1) Excluir a tela 0001
2) No include /PWS/LZYCEGF1F01, aplicar os seguintes ajustes:
* >> Início da inclusão
FORM preenche_data_zycev020. "#EC CALLED
* << Fim da inclusão
* >> Início da exclusão
FORM preenche_data_zycev020.
* << Fim da exclusão
DATA: f_index LIKE sy-tabix.
...
IF <fs_conteudo>-action = aendern
OR <fs_conteudo>-action = neuer_eintrag.
* >> Início da inclusão
READ TABLE extract WITH KEY table_line = total.
* << Fim da inclusão
* >> Início da exclusão
READ TABLE extract WITH KEY total.
* << Fim da exclusão
IF sy-subrc EQ 0.
...
* >> Início da inclusão
FORM preenche_data_zycev023. "#EC CALLED
* << Fim da inclusão
* >> Início da exclusão
FORM preenche_data_zycev023.
* << Fim da exclusão
DATA: f_index LIKE sy-tabix.
...
IF <fs_conteudo>-action = aendern
OR <fs_conteudo>-action = neuer_eintrag.
* >> Início da inclusão
READ TABLE extract WITH KEY table_line = total.
* << Fim da inclusão
* >> Início da exclusão
READ TABLE extract WITH KEY total.
* << Fim da exclusão
IF sy-subrc EQ 0.
...
* >> Início da inclusão
FORM preenche_data_zycev130. "#EC CALLED
* << Fim da inclusão
* >> Início da exclusão
FORM preenche_data_zycev130.
* << Fim da exclusão
DATA: f_index LIKE sy-tabix.
...
IF <fs_conteudo>-action = aendern
OR <fs_conteudo>-action = neuer_eintrag.
* >> Início da inclusão
READ TABLE extract WITH KEY table_line = total.
* << Fim da inclusão
* >> Início da exclusão
READ TABLE extract WITH KEY total.
* << Fim da exclusão
IF sy-subrc EQ 0.
...
4) Na tela 0321
Modificar o campo de texto */PWS/ZYCET321-TIPOEMB, alterando o texto do dicionário para tipo 1
(Texto: curto)
5) Na tela 0322
Modificar o campo de texto /PWS/ZYCET321-TIPOEMB, alterando o texto do dicionário para tipo 1
(Texto: curto)
6) Na tela 0280
Modificar o campo de texto */PWS/ZYCET280-RESOLUCAO, alterando o texto do dicionário para tipo F
(Texto: texto fixo, modificado; sem transferência de texto) e definindo o texto de exibição desse
campo para "Texto".
7) Na tela 0020
Modificar o campo de texto */PWS/ZYCEV020-HRUSERC, alterando o texto do dicionário para tipo 2
(Texto: médio)